A hydraulic press consists of two cylinders: one with a piston for work and the other with a plunger that pushes down on the fluid. As pressure builds in one cylinder, it is transmitted into the bottom of the larger one and produces mechanical force that propels anvils and dies.
A hydraulic press is a positive displacement system based on Pascal's principle. The pump and cylinder are enclosed within an enclosed container, maintaining consistent pressure throughout the system.

Hydraulic presses are essential in many manufacturing operations. They enable operators to fit, bend and assemble sheet metal parts, bearings and equipment.
Therefore, proper maintenance of a hydraulic press is necessary in order to extend its usefulness. This includes keeping it clean and well-lubricated with fresh oil at all times.
Maintaining the temperature of a press is essential for its longevity. Utilizing air or water coolers and thermostats are both effective ways of maintaining this ideal setting.
Furthermore, hydraulic presses must be checked for leaks on their hydraulic lines. Failure to do so could result in costly repair expenses.
